Frozen Yogurt Bark

Creamy Greek yogurt meets fresh berries, crunchy nuts and dark chocolate. This if frozen into a beautiful bark you can snap and snack on straight from the freezer. High in protein, naturally sweet and almost too pretty to eat.

Ingredients
  

  • 250 g Greek yogurt
  • 1-2 tsp Vanilla powder (not vanilla sugar)
  • Berries of your choice
  • Nuts or granola
Optional
  • 2 bites 90% dark chocolate
  • 1 tbsp Honey

Method
 

  1. Mix the Greek yogurt with vanilla powder.
  2. Spread over a parchment lined baking sheet.
  3. Add your berries, nuts or granola and dark chocolate on top.
  4. Pop in the freezer for at least 4 hours.

Notes

🥛 Greek yogurt: You can also use vanilla flavoured Greek yogurt if you don’t have any vanilla powder at home.
🍓 Berries: Any berries work beautifully. I love a mix of strawberries, and blueberries for colour and flavour but the options are endless.
